About Class Action Law in Republic of Lithuania:

Class action law in the Republic of Lithuania allows a group of people with a common legal issue to bring a collective lawsuit against the same defendant. This type of legal action is often used when a large group of individuals have been harmed in a similar way, such as by a faulty product or a company's misconduct.

Why You May Need a Lawyer:

You may need a lawyer in class action cases to ensure your rights are protected and to help you navigate the complex legal process. A lawyer can help you determine if you have a valid claim, gather evidence, negotiate settlements, and represent you in court if necessary.

Local Laws Overview:

In Lithuania, class action lawsuits are governed by the Civil Code and the Law on Consumer Protection. These laws outline the requirements for bringing a class action suit, the rights of class members, and the procedures for resolving such cases.

Frequently Asked Questions:

Q: What is a class action lawsuit?

A class action lawsuit is a legal action brought by a group of people who have suffered similar harm from the same defendant.

Q: How do I know if I qualify to join a class action lawsuit in Lithuania?

To qualify for a class action lawsuit in Lithuania, you must have suffered harm or damages that are similar to those of other class members and have a common legal claim against the defendant.

Q: What types of cases are typically brought as class action lawsuits in Lithuania?

Class action lawsuits in Lithuania are often brought in cases involving consumer rights violations, product liability, environmental damage, and securities fraud.

Q: Is there a time limit for filing a class action lawsuit in Lithuania?

Yes, there is a statute of limitations for filing class action lawsuits in Lithuania, typically ranging from 1 to 10 years depending on the nature of the case.

Q: What are the potential outcomes of a class action lawsuit in Lithuania?

Potential outcomes of a class action lawsuit in Lithuania include financial compensation for class members, injunctive relief to prevent future harm, and public awareness of the issue.

Q: How are class action lawsuits funded in Lithuania?

In Lithuania, class action lawsuits are typically funded by the law firms representing the class members on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if the case is successful.

Q: Can I opt out of a class action lawsuit in Lithuania?

Yes, in Lithuania, class members have the right to opt out of a class action lawsuit if they wish to pursue separate legal action or settlements.

Q: What are the advantages of joining a class action lawsuit in Lithuania?

The advantages of joining a class action lawsuit in Lithuania include cost-sharing, increased leverage against the defendant, and the ability to hold large corporations accountable for their actions.

Q: How long does a class action lawsuit typically take to resolve in Lithuania?

Class action lawsuits in Lithuania can vary in length, but they typically take several months to several years to resolve depending on the complexity of the case and the legal process involved.

Q: Can I appeal the outcome of a class action lawsuit in Lithuania?

Yes, class members in Lithuania have the right to appeal the outcome of a class action lawsuit if they believe there were errors in the legal process or the judgment.
